I structured query language i usually talk to a database server i used as front end to many databases mysql, postgresql, oracle, sybase i three subsystems. Linked servers is a concept in sql server by which we can add other sql server to a group and query both the sql server dbs using t sql statements. Supported query types visual database tools 01192017. Basic sql sql language considered one of the major reasons for the commercial success of relational databases sql structured query language statements for data definitions, queries, and updates both ddl and dml core specification plus specialized extensions. A classic query engine handles all the non sql queries, but a sql query engine wont handle logical files. Sql is the standard language for relational database system. Some of the examples use the table shop to hold the price of each article item number for certain traders dealers. A query is an access object used to view, analyze, or modify data. Sql 3 sql commands the standard sql commands to interact with relational databases are create, select. Sql is a language of database, it includes database creation, deletion, fetching rows and modifying rows etc. Free sql books download ebooks online textbooks tutorials. This tutorial uses transact sql, the microsoft implementation of the. Read online filemaker sql reference book pdf free download link book now.
Sap hana supports the standard sql search syntax and functions for search queries on nearly all visible data types. Advanced sql queries, examples of queries in sql list of top. Query design as with other access objects, you can either create the query in design view or use the. Sql has no direct way to query all records that have all possible relations of a certain type its easy to query which relations of a certain type a record has. Transaction control language tcl consist of commands which deal with the transaction of the database. This course is adapted to your level as well as all sql pdf courses to better enrich your knowledge. All the relational database management systems rdms like mysql, ms access, oracle, sybase, informix, postgres. None of the rows in the salary grade table contain grades that overlap. Complex queries this chapter describes more advanced features of the sql language standard for relational databases. N relationship like students to taken courses its not that simple. Oracle database sql quick reference is intended for all users of oracle sql. Mar 12, 2020 download a printable pdf of this cheat sheet. The statements which defines the structure of a database, create tables, specify their keys, indexes and so on. Ql tutorial gives unique learning on structured query language and it helps to make practice on sql commands which provides immediate results.
Differentiate between sql statements and sqlplus commands lesson aim to extract data from the database. Start the commandline tool mysql and select a database. Query all data types with sql server 2019 big data clusters. All sql queries perform some type of data operation such as selecting data, insertingupdating data, or creating data objects such as sql databases and sql tables. Dbcc checkalloc to check that all pages in a db are correctly allocated. Following is a simple diagram showing the sql architecture. This pyspark sql cheat sheet has included almost all important concepts. Saving data from sql server database into a pdf file. Writing views in sql server sql server client helps you create views and write queries through query byexample qbe interface views, right click, new view add tables in query control click check boxes for columns in result write where clauses in grid not all views can be updated. The return value can be a single value or a result set. Sql cheat sheet download pdf it in pdf or png format.
A read is counted each time someone views a publication summary such as the title, abstract, and list of authors, clicks on a figure, or views or downloads the fulltext. Register for free and get sql interview questions pdf. Correlated nested queries correlated nested query evaluated once for each tuple in the outer query such queries are easiest to understand and write correctly if all column names are qualified by their relation names. Assemble all tables according to from clause, means to use. In this blog, you will learn about the basic types of sql statements with examples. The commands in sql are called queries and they are of two types. Supported query types visual database tools microsoft docs.
All you need to do is download the training document, open it and start learning sql for free. Sql coins the term query as the name for its commands. Note that the inner query can refer to e, but the outer query cannot refer to d. This part of the sql tutorial includes the basic sql commands cheat sheet. Here you will learn various aspects of sql that are possibly asked in the interviews. Take advantage of this course called sql queries tutorial to improve your database skills and better understand sql. Here are examples of how to solve some common problems with mysql. Lecture outline more complex sql retrieval queries selfjoins renaming attributes and results. Customized functions in sql are generally used to perform complex calculations and return the result as a value. Hope this article named complex sql queries examples is useful to all the programmers. This is a powerful way to take advantage of the fact that any sql query returns a table which can they be the starting point of another sql query. Supports tabular, crosstab, charts, scheduling, dashboards, export to spreadsheet and pdf. Filemaker sql reference pdf book manual free download. Sql, s tructured q uery l anguage, is a programming language designed to manage data stored in relational databases.
Sql stands for structured query language, as it is the special purpose domain specific language for querying data in relational database management system rdbms. Pdf version of t sql tutorial with content of stored procedures, sql tutorial, cursors, triggers, views, functions, data types, table joins, transactions, interview questions. Sql is structured query language, which is a computer language for storing, manipulating and retrieving data stored in a relational database. In order to better understand sql, all the example queries make use of a simple database. In this reference, a toplevel select statement is called a query, and a query nested within another sql statement is called a subquery. Mysql, sql server, ms access, oracle, sybase, informix, postgres, and other database systems. All you need is a windows machine and we will walk through setting up an environment, to creating a database, creating your first table and writing queries. Sql allows us to rename tables for the duration of a query. In case you are looking to learn pyspark sql indepth, you should check out the spark, scala, and python training certification provided by intellipaat. Sql server azure sql database azure synapse analytics sql dw parallel data warehouse you can create the following types of queries in the diagram and criteria panes the graphical panes of the query and view designer select query retrieves data from one or. Practice sql queries with solutions for employee table. This section describes some types of queries and subqueries and how to use them. Values returns a table, after evaluating all expressions.
The top level of the syntax is shown in this chapter. Today, we will focus on a particular type and that is sql query interview questions. Apart from the above commands, the following topics will also be covered in this article. Just inner join the two tables and you are done but in an m. Sep 09, 2018 join scaler academy by interviewbit, indias 1st jobdriven online techversity.
It has features that make it a simple yet effective reporting and business intelligence solution. This cheat sheet will guide you through the basic sql commands required to learn and work on sql. If you are writing a big query, you can find yourself typing the same long table names in again and again. You put the new name immediately after the table name in from, separated by a space. At the end of this course, you should be comfortable writing queries for multiple situations and reports. Basic sql structured query language considered one of the major reasons for the commercial success of relational databases statements for data definitions, queries, and updates both ddl and dml core specification plus specialized extensions terminology. Sql is a language of database, it includes database creation. Sql is a basic query language which every programmer must know. Additionally, queries allow you to join two or more related tables, concatenate text fields, summarize data, create calculated fields, and append, update, or delete. This is an indispensable handbook for any developer who is challenged with writing complex sql inside applications. These functions are created by user in the system database, and we have 3 types of user define functions.
Mar 24, 2020 download filemaker sql reference book pdf free download link or read online here in pdf. Thiss what a cursor want to execute a select statement get one record at a time. Supposing that each trader has a single fixed price per article, then article, dealer is a primary key for the records. This tutorial is intended for users who are new to writing sql statements. All books are in clear copy here, and all files are secure so dont worry about it. Additional data types timestamp data type timestamp includes the date and time fields plus a minimum of six positions for decimal fractions of seconds optional with time zone qualifier interval data type. This quick reference contains a highlevel description of the structured query language sql used to manage information in an oracle database. Writing transact sql statements sql server 2012 books online summary.
Sql commands tutorial list of sql commands with example. There are two main categories of query types in access select and action queries. Art is a lightweight, multiplatform, web application that enables quick deployment of sql query results. The objective of this sql blog is to make you familiar with different types of sql functions with examples and the basic syntax. They provide key elements of a data lakehadoop distributed file system hdfs, apache spark, and analytics toolsdeeply integrated with sql server and fully supported by microsoft. With our online sql editor, you can edit the sql statements, and click on a button to view the result. This will trigger a download on the client side and everything will look like a normal download. Accelerate your tech skills in 6months and land a job at the top tech companies globally.
Dbcc checkfilegroup checks all tables file group for any damage. Data control language dcl consists of commands which deal with the user permissions and controls of the database system. This lesson describes all ihe sql statements that you need to. Select statement may return many records select empid, name, salary from employee where salary 120,000. Sql server 2019 brings innovative security and compliance features, industryleading performance, missioncritical availability, and advanced analytics to all your key data workloads, now with support for big data builtin.
Query all rows and columns from a table select c1, c2 from t. The query design determines the fields and records you see and the sort order. This article gives you the idea about complex sql queries examples and will be useful to all the programmers. This reference contains a complete description of the structured query language sql used to manage information in an oracle database. Multiple simultaneous changes to data, uses of databases, ways to use sql, some relational database concepts,variable types, create table statement, entering observations into a table, comparison operators, updating a table, the select statement, selecting based on summaries, subqueries, making tables from queries. Sql is a standard language for storing, manipulating and retrieving data in databases. Sql server azure sql database azure synapse analytics sql dw parallel data warehouse data manipulation language dml is a vocabulary used to retrieve and work with data in sql server 2019 15. Update new value in the column c1 for all rows managing tables using sql constraints modifying data alter table t add constraint. The basic form is just to list all the needed tables. This lesson describes all ihe sql statements that you need to perform these actions.
Manage your big data environment more easily with big data clusters. If you are an database administrator or a database analyst oor someone who wants to know how to manipulate data from employee tables in your organization, you can use make use of this sql solutions. This keeps data accurate and secure, and it helps maintain the integrity of databases, regardless of size. Sql query interview questions practice all types of sql. Sql functions, operators, expressions, and predicates 5 additional information to maintain the quality of our products and services, we would like your comments on the accuracy, clarity, organization, and value of this document. Your contribution will go a long way in helping us serve. That is, the salary value for an employee can only lie between the low salary and high salary. Sql query interview questions practice all types of sql queries. In this blogpost we would be providing sample practice sql queries with solutions for employee table. First, we have provided you with a sample table which you. So, in this blog, you will find the interview questions based on complex sql queries that you can practice online. Sql functions, operators, expressions, and predicates. Sql window functions, ctes, lateral jsonb and spgist functions overview function basics functions by example query syntax simple queries joins set operations subqueries queries syntax overview values, table last, but not least, the most complicated ones of all.
Introduction to sql finding your way around the server since a single server can support many databases, each containing many tables, with each table having a variety of columns, its easy to get lost when youre working with. Basic sql structured query language considered one of the major reasons for the commercial success of relational databases statements for data definitions, queries, and updates both ddl and dml. Sql operates through simple, declarative statements. Summary of presentation bases of sql discussion of sql features through examples criticism of sql standardization 1 sql, october 7, 2008 1 sql. Earlier we have discussed the different types of sql questions asked in the interview. It is important to note that all employees appear exactly once when this query is executed. Advanced sql tutorial pdf improving my sql bi skills.
Basically, all sql code is written in the form of a query statement and then executed against a database. Microsoft sql server 2019 features added to sql server on linux. This site is like a library, you could find million book here by using search box in the header. The oracle database sql language quick reference is intended for all users of oracle sql.